Responsibilities


As a Founding Applied AI Scientist / Engineer at Argon, you will help lead our AI efforts. Your efforts will be focused on building domain specific AI and RAG systems on top of large pharma datasets. We are looking for individuals with past AI / ML experience that are excited about building the agentic pharma systems of the future. 

  1. Balancing product and research. You want to operate at the frontier of applied AI. You stay up to date with research on prompting techniques, model capabilities, domain specific finetuning 
  2. Master of prompts & agentic workflows. You’ll lead our efforts to get models to perform how we want them to. This includes getting the right tone & format but also enabling models with tool use, in-context-learning (ICL), and other techniques to get the very best out of the LLMs. 
  3. Building a proprietary dataset. Work with the team to commission the creation of pharma workflows specific datasets that can be used for continued pre-training, RLHF, in-context-learning (ICL), and other applications. 
  4. Create a fine-tuning strategy. Lead the team in thinking through domain-specific fine tuning and model training and deploy resources thoughtfully to help us achieve SOTA performance on pharma specific benchmarks 
  5. Create evaluations & benchmarks. Design and run the first even pharma domain specific benchmarks for model performance on very specific pharma operational tasks.
